Ingredients
- 1/2 cup cider vinegar
- 2 tablespoons sugar
- 2 tablespoons ranch dressing
- 1/2 cup chopped fresh cilantro leaves
- 1 (16-ounce) bag tri-color cole slaw
Directions
In a medium bowl, mix together cider vinegar, dressing, cilantro, and sugar.
Add coleslaw and toss together.
